(919) 469-4061 www.townofcary.org 47 BIRTHDAYS sKateBoard and BMX parties Have an extreme birthday at Sk8-Cary! An instructor will lead your private party in a series of activities and games in our 12,000 square-foot park for 2 hours. After that, you'll have a table reserved on the deck for refreshments. Invitations, paper products, drinks, pizza, & rental safety gear are all included! Call (919) 380-2970 for details and availability. Location: Sk8-Cary Fees: $125 (Members) $150 (Non-members) Fusion BirtHday parties (age 3-10) Supercharge your birthday party! Invite up to 25 friends and play games like Freeze, Animal Action, Wonderball, Red Light/Green Light, Around the World Basketball, Musical Mats and more! Instructor will lead dance, games and fitness activities for the first hour. The second hour is set aside for gifts, refreshments and clean-up. Location: Middle Creek Community Center Instructor: Stacy Smith Fees: $175 (R) $205 (N) dance BirtHday parties (age 6-12) Design it yourself dance party! Certified dance instructor Stacy Smith will help you create a fun-filled cool dance format for you and 25 friends. Choose from Hip Hop, Zumba, cardio funk, ballet, tap and broadway style jazz. Instructor leads party for 1st hour, the second hour is reserved for gifts, refreshments, and clean-up. Location: Middle Creek Community Center Instructor: Stacy Smith Fees: $175 (R) $205 (N) art & draMa BirtHday parties Get creative with your birthday this year! Choose from "Art Party," a fun, hands-on art class or, "Party with Applause!" for a drama work- shop and performance of a skit you create. Parties may be custom- ized if you have a theme in mind. Call for details, including age requirements and maximum party sizes. Location: Cary Arts Center Fees: $175 (R) $205 (N) Fee includes room rental and class; parents provide set-up, clean-up, decorations, and refreshments.
